Event narrative

One to three inches of snow lead to numerous accidents across the county. A 56 year man died near El Dorado, KS., when he lost control of his pickup truck that rolled over. Another accident, near the Augusta airport, injured two people as the vehicle they were driving left the highway and hit a parked recreational vehicle. The driver of the vehicle had to be extricated and flown to a hospital in Wichita.

Wider weather episode

The first snowfall of the season lead to numerous accidents across South Central and Southeast Kansas, as an upper level disturbance moved across the area. This upper level disturbance lead to 1 to 3 inches of snow across portions of Southern Kansas.
